Publisher's Synopsis

The International Law Reports is the only publication in the world wholly devoted to the regular and systematic reporting in English of decisions of international courts and arbitrators as well as judgments of national courts. Volume 134 reports on, amongst others, the decisions on the death penalty from the Inter-American Court of Human Rights, the United Nations Human Rights Committee and the courts of Barbados, Jamaica, Malawi, Singapore and Trinidad and Tobago; the decisions from the International Court of Justice (LaGrand and Avena) and the European Court of Human Rights (Mamatkulov) on the nature and scope of provisional/interim measures; and the decisions from the International Court of Justice (LaGrand and Avena) and the United States of America (Sanchez-Llamas) on consular relations/Article 36 of the Vienna Convention on Consular Relations, 1963.
